    In this diary - Divisional Troops 168 Brigade Royal Field Artillery (1916-01-01) (31 Dec 1915 - 30 Oct 1919) - every month has at least 8 two-column pages of names and numbers, and maybe a few more pages of arrivals and departures. If the administrators of this site are wondering why this batch of diaries is taking so long for volunteers to get through, it's entirely because of this diary. I've been working on it for 3 weeks and I'm only 2/3 of the way done with it. I can only do one month before all those names and numbers start driving me nuts, and then I have to do something else for a while.

    Yes, we know that this particular diary is slow-going for the volunteers working on it. Feel free to take a break from it when you need to and work on a different diary, or even abandon it altogether. It will eventually get tagged if we all do a bit of it.

    It is, however, a real treasure as a historical document! So far at least, we haven't seen such details regarding the officers and particularly the men of an artillery brigade. We truly appreciate the effort that everyone is putting into getting this diary tagged.
